Cambridge has a job mowing lawns. He mowed 5 lawns last week and earned $82.50. The table shows his earnings for the week. Which

coordinate pair represents the unit rate for this situation?
Mathematics
2 answers:
NeTakaya3 years ago
8 0
For every lawn Cambridge mows he earns 16.50 USD, knowing this we now know the unit rate. The unit rate is (1,16.50).

Derek was 4 years 2 months old when he joined school. Today he is 11 years 1 month old. For how long has he been in school?
lora16 [44]

Answer:

hi

Step-by-step explanation:

first of all,we should do this:

1 year is 12 month

amd 4 year is 48 month(12×4)

then we must add 2 months (wich is given) to 48

He was 50 months old when he started school

and we should find how old is he now

11 ×12=132months

132+1=133months

133-50=83 ( he has been 83 months in school)

let's turn it to years 6 years 11 months

( for finding years you should divide 83 to 12)
